After all, the vast majority of measurement activities are not related to issues of fairness in transactions or deliveries, nor to public health or safety concerns. In most cases, measuring instruments are used as components for automated control; it is sufficient for these instruments to be able to detect changes in the quantity being measured in order to meet the control requirements. . . The measurement accuracy of the instrument is a secondary issue. . . Even if the instrument is not very accurate or reliable, it can be perfectly compensated for through other inexpensive technical methods. For example, the 4–20mA continuous level gauge installed on the tank is not very accurate; however, there are two additional level switches on the tank, and these switches are interlocked with the pumps and valves to ensure that the liquid neither overflows nor runs out. For another example, the radar level gauges installed on the storage tanks sometimes give false readings – they may report that the tank is full when it’s actually empty, or vice versa. There are also cases where the readings don’t change at all. However, chemical plants have many instrument technicians on standby to deal with such issues. As soon as the radar gives a false reading, the technicians immediately cut off its power supply, or switch to manual control mode. Thanks to this, the tanks never run out of fluid or overflow. . . Type certification for measuring instruments has existed in the past. In the past, after type approval was obtained, additional assessments were carried out on the site, equipment, personnel, and other conditions; once all these conditions were met, a manufacturing license for measuring instruments would be issued.
